How to Choose the Right Seal Width for Your Bags
Choosing the right width is a balance between your storage habits and your available space. A 2mm seal is standard for most thin pantry items, while a 5mm seal is much stronger and better suited for heavy-duty freezer bags.
- Thin/Snack bags: 2mm seal width is sufficient and prevents melting through the material.
- Bulk/Dry goods: 3mm to 5mm width provides a more secure, permanent closure.
- Heavy-duty/Freezer bags: 5mm or dual-seal bars are necessary to handle thicker, moisture-resistant plastics.
Always check the manufacturer’s specifications for the maximum bag thickness the sealer can handle. If you try to seal a bag that is too thick for the machine, you will end up with a weak, incomplete seal that fails almost immediately.
Safety Tips for Using Heat Sealers in the Kitchen
Heat sealers work by reaching high temperatures in a fraction of a second. Always keep your fingers away from the seal bar while the unit is plugged in or during the cooling phase.
If you are using a plug-in model, make sure the cord is kept away from water sources like the kitchen sink. When you are finished, allow the unit to cool down completely before wrapping the cord or storing it in a drawer to prevent melting the plastic casing.
Finally, keep these tools out of reach of children. Even a small impulse sealer can cause a painful burn if a finger comes into contact with the heating element.
Troubleshooting Common Impulse Sealer Issues
If your sealer isn’t producing a good bond, the most common culprit is a dirty seal bar. Over time, plastic residue can build up, preventing the heat from transferring evenly; simply wipe it down with a damp cloth once it is completely cold.
Another frequent issue is a burned-out heating element or a worn-out Teflon cover. Most impulse sealers come with a replacement kit, which is a simple fix that involves unscrewing the old wire and snapping the new one into place.
If the seal is melting through the bag, you are likely using too much heat or holding the lever down for too long. Turn the heat setting down by one increment and practice on a scrap piece of the same bag material until you find the "sweet spot."
